On Thursday at a Super Bowl Media conference room, Jerry Rice, Mike Ditka, Trent Dilfer, and Cris Carter were all available to the media for about an hour. I tried to get at least seven or eight minutes of each guy and below in this article, I have posted the group interview with Mike Ditka, Hall of Famer and head coach of the 1985 Super Bowl Champion Chicago Bears.
I get a question in to Ditka about what the Bears need to work on this off-season and he had quite a lot to say on the matter, and voiced his disagreement with Lovie Smith’s firing. That video is below (apologies for the blur factor) and my question is at 8:30.
Other highlights include Ditka saying “come on, man” to both the Dan Marino‘s love child story and Randy Moss claiming he is the best wide receiver in the history of the game. He said after that he thought the two best wide receivers in the game were both in the room that day. That would be referring to Jerry Rice and Cris Carter. Ditka appeared relaxed and happy to be back in New Orleans for this game; he was the coach of the New Orleans Saints for three years after his time with the Bears and still has a soft spot for the city and its people.
